From racing between the tape to calling the action from the booth, Josh Carlson has experienced mountain biking from every angle. In this episode, we dive into his unique journey from pro Enduro racer to one of the key voices in the sport’s global broadcast. Josh shares what it’s like working behind the mic for Warner Brothers, how he connects with athletes and audiences, and why storytelling is at the heart of great coverage. We also get into the evolution of Enduro, the grind of balancing family life, racing and media, and what it takes to build a personal brand that truly represents the sport. This is a behind-the-scenes look at what goes into broadcasting the sport we all love, so sit back, hit play, and enjoy this conversation with Josh Carlson.
